A new test for estimating iliotibial band contracture

V. K. Gautam, MS, Associate Professor of Orthopaedics; and S. Anand, MS, Registrar

Department of Orthopaedics, Maulana Azad Medical College, New Delhi 110002, India.

Correspondence should be sent to Dr V. K. Gautam.

Contracture of the iliotibial band leading to flexion and abduction deformity at the hip is common in residual paralysis after polio. Ober’s test has been used to detect this, but it is unreliable and cannot determine the degree of contracture.

We describe a new test which quantifies this contracture and can be used for comparative purposes.
